Revert "Cleans up SOYC options: ", trunk@6416, due to
checkstyle build break.


git-svn-id: https://google-web-toolkit.googlecode.com/svn/trunk@6417 8db76d5a-ed1c-0410-87a9-c151d255dfc7
diff --git a/dev/core/src/com/google/gwt/dev/Precompile.java b/dev/core/src/com/google/gwt/dev/Precompile.java
index 435465b..811892d 100644
--- a/dev/core/src/com/google/gwt/dev/Precompile.java
+++ b/dev/core/src/com/google/gwt/dev/Precompile.java
@@ -43,7 +43,6 @@
 import com.google.gwt.dev.util.Memory;
 import com.google.gwt.dev.util.PerfLogger;
 import com.google.gwt.dev.util.Util;
-import com.google.gwt.dev.util.arg.ArgHandlerCompileReport;
 import com.google.gwt.dev.util.arg.ArgHandlerDisableAggressiveOptimization;
 import com.google.gwt.dev.util.arg.ArgHandlerDisableCastChecking;
 import com.google.gwt.dev.util.arg.ArgHandlerDisableClassMetadata;
@@ -106,7 +105,6 @@
       registerHandler(new ArgHandlerDisableUpdateCheck(options));
       registerHandler(new ArgHandlerDumpSignatures(options));
       registerHandler(new ArgHandlerMaxPermsPerPrecompile(options));
-      registerHandler(new ArgHandlerCompileReport(options));
       registerHandler(new ArgHandlerSoyc(options));
       registerHandler(new ArgHandlerSoycDetailed(options));
     }
diff --git a/dev/core/src/com/google/gwt/dev/util/arg/ArgHandlerCompileReport.java b/dev/core/src/com/google/gwt/dev/util/arg/ArgHandlerCompileReport.java
deleted file mode 100644
index 02b1c78..0000000
--- a/dev/core/src/com/google/gwt/dev/util/arg/ArgHandlerCompileReport.java
+++ /dev/null
@@ -1,46 +0,0 @@
-/*
- * Copyright 2009 Google Inc.
- * 
- * Licensed under the Apache License, Version 2.0 (the "License"); you may not
- * use this file except in compliance with the License. You may obtain a copy of
- * the License at
- * 
- * http://www.apache.org/licenses/LICENSE-2.0
- * 
- * Unless required by applicable law or agreed to in writing, software
- * distributed under the License is distributed on an "AS IS" BASIS, WITHOUT
- * W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. See the
- * License for the specific language governing permissions and limitations under
- * the License.
- */
-package com.google.gwt.dev.util.arg;
-
-import com.google.gwt.util.tools.ArgHandlerFlag;
-
-/**
- * An ArgHandler that enables Story Of Your Compile data-collection.
- */
-public class ArgHandlerCompileReport extends ArgHandlerFlag {
-
-  private final OptionSoycEnabled options;
-
-  public ArgHandlerCompileReport(OptionSoycEnabled options) {
-    this.options = options;
-  }
-
-  @Override
-  public String getPurpose() {
-    return "Enable Compile Report (Story of Your Compile)";
-  }
-
-  @Override
-  public String getTag() {
-    return "-compileReport";
-  }
-
-  @Override
-  public boolean setFlag() {
-    options.setSoycEnabled(true);
-    return true;
-  }
-}
diff --git a/dev/core/src/com/google/gwt/dev/util/arg/ArgHandlerSoyc.java b/dev/core/src/com/google/gwt/dev/util/arg/ArgHandlerSoyc.java
index bf6b17c..0bcdabd 100644
--- a/dev/core/src/com/google/gwt/dev/util/arg/ArgHandlerSoyc.java
+++ b/dev/core/src/com/google/gwt/dev/util/arg/ArgHandlerSoyc.java
@@ -39,11 +39,6 @@
   }
 
   @Override
-  public boolean isUndocumented() {
-    return true;
-  }
-
-  @Override
   public boolean setFlag() {
     options.setSoycEnabled(true);
     return true;
diff --git a/dev/core/src/com/google/gwt/dev/util/arg/ArgHandlerSoycDetailed.java b/dev/core/src/com/google/gwt/dev/util/arg/ArgHandlerSoycDetailed.java
index 3fb028c..c278399 100644
--- a/dev/core/src/com/google/gwt/dev/util/arg/ArgHandlerSoycDetailed.java
+++ b/dev/core/src/com/google/gwt/dev/util/arg/ArgHandlerSoycDetailed.java
@@ -45,7 +45,6 @@
   @Override
   public boolean setFlag() {
     options.setSoycExtra(true);
-    options.setSoycEnabled(true);
     return true;
   }
 }
diff --git a/dev/core/src/com/google/gwt/dev/util/arg/OptionSoycDetailed.java b/dev/core/src/com/google/gwt/dev/util/arg/OptionSoycDetailed.java
index 2e32b8a..6ab0217 100644
--- a/dev/core/src/com/google/gwt/dev/util/arg/OptionSoycDetailed.java
+++ b/dev/core/src/com/google/gwt/dev/util/arg/OptionSoycDetailed.java
@@ -30,10 +30,4 @@
    * information.
    */
   void setSoycExtra(boolean soycExtra);
-
-  /**
-   * Sets whether or not the compiler should record and emit SOYC information
-   * and build the dashboard.
-   */
-  void setSoycEnabled(boolean enabled);
 }